Buddhist monks from Thailand’s Sisaket province collected a million bottles to build the Wat Pa Maha Chedi Kaew temple. Why?? It has something to do with the Heineken Beer company changing its bottle years ago into working as a useful building block. Don’t ask, I don’t know.
